House - 02/07/06

"Need to Know" Episode #211.
Spoiler:
A housewife (Julie Warner) on fertility medication visits Princeton Plainsboro Hospital when her inexplicable muscle-flailing causes her to crash her car.


Cast: Hugh Laurie, Lisa Edelstein, Omar Epps, Robert Sean Leonard, Jennifer Morrison, Jesse Spencer, Sela Ward,.
Producer(s): Paul Attanasio, Katie Jacobs, David Shore, Bryan Singer.

Original Airdate: February 7, 2006.

You can do an AIDS/HIV test from a mouth swab? I thought you had to draw blood.

There are fairly new (half a decade or so) saliva based tests that can detect incredibly, incredibly diluted amounts of HIV virus, but they're less accurate..

Saliva does carry HIV virus particles, but it's not generally considered a method of transmitting HIV because you actually need quite a few virus particles to be infected with HIV, and the salivary concentration is very low.
